Understanding Canvas: Your Online Learning Hub

Canvas is a robust platform designed to streamline online education. It acts as a central hub for everything related to your courses, offering features like:

  • Course Materials: Access lecture notes, readings, videos, and other learning resources.
  • Assignments: Submit assignments, view due dates, and receive feedback from your instructors.
  • Grades: Track your progress and see your grades for each assignment and course.
  • Communication: Interact with your instructors and classmates through discussions, announcements, and private messages.
  • Calendar: Keep track of important deadlines, assignments, and events.

Getting Started: The Sign-Up Process

The process for signing up for Canvas varies slightly depending on your educational institution. Here’s a general overview:

1. Access the Canvas Portal: Your school will typically provide a link to their Canvas portal on their website. Look for a tab or section labeled “Canvas,” “Online Learning,” or something similar.
2. Login with Your Credentials: You’ll likely need your student ID number and password. If you’re a new student, you might be provided with temporary credentials or instructions on setting up an account.
3. Follow On-Screen Instructions: The Canvas platform will guide you through the initial setup process. This may involve selecting your courses, confirming your personal information, and setting up your profile.

Navigating Your Canvas Dashboard: A Student’s Guide

Once you’re logged in, you’ll be greeted by your Canvas dashboard. This is your personalized home base for all your courses. Here’s a breakdown of the key elements:

  • Course Cards: These cards display your enrolled courses, offering quick access to course information, recent activity, and upcoming assignments.
  • Navigation Menu: Located on the left side of the screen, this menu provides access to various features like your profile, grades, calendar, and messages.
  • Notifications: Stay informed about important updates, assignment deadlines, and messages from your instructors.
  • Global Navigation: This bar at the top of the screen allows you to quickly access features like the Canvas homepage, your profile, and help resources.

Essential Canvas Features for Student Success

Mastering these key features will enhance your learning experience and help you stay organized:

  • Modules: Courses are often structured into modules, which contain organized content and assignments. Navigate through modules to access learning materials and complete tasks.
  • Discussions: Engage with your classmates and instructors in online discussions. Share your thoughts, ask questions, and collaborate on projects.
  • Assignments: Submit assignments, view grading rubrics, and track your progress. Utilize the “Submit Assignment” feature to upload your work.
  • Calendar: Stay on top of deadlines, events, and other important dates. Add reminders and sync your Canvas calendar with your personal calendar for maximum organization.
  • Grades: Track your performance in each course and view your grades for individual assignments.

Q: What if I forget my Canvas login credentials?

A: If you forget your password, you can usually reset it by clicking on the “Forgot Password” link on the login page. You’ll need to provide your student ID number or email address to initiate the password reset process.

Q: Is Canvas compatible with my mobile device?

A: Yes, Canvas has a dedicated mobile app available for both iOS and Android devices. This allows you to access your courses, submit assignments, and stay connected with your instructors and classmates on the go.

Q: Can I customize my Canvas dashboard?

A: Absolutely! Canvas allows you to personalize your dashboard by rearranging course cards, adding widgets, and adjusting settings to suit your preferences.

Q: How do I contact Canvas support if I need assistance?

A: Most institutions provide direct contact information for their Canvas support team. You can usually find this information on the Canvas homepage or within the help resources section. You can also access general Canvas support resources through the Canvas website.

Q: Is Canvas free for students?

A: Access to Canvas is typically included as part of your tuition or fees at your educational institution. You won’t need to pay any additional fees to use the platform.
